Mugie Conservancy is home to a rich variety of wildlife, including big cats, elephants, and one of Kenya’s rare northern white rhinos. Guests can explore the reserve on game drives, guided bush walks, and camel safaris, as well as engage in conservation-focused activities such as tracking collared lions or visiting the anti-poaching bloodhound unit. The conservancy also features a unique golf course, offering a one-of-a-kind safari-and-golf experience.
